Warmwell Rise Brings Green Open Space and Investment to Crossways

A new neighbourhood has opened in Crossways, with our new development Warmwell Rise delivering new homes, welcoming green open space and over £1.37 million in investment to support the local community.

A Well-Attended Community Launch

We officially launched the development at a public event, welcoming local residents and visitors from Crossways and the surrounding villages to explore the site and find out more about the new homes now taking shape.

Families, first-time buyers and downsizers spent time walking the development and exploring the show home, where they asked questions and got a feel for what life at Warmwell Rise could look like, ahead of the first residents moving into their new homes this summer and bringing a growing new community to the Dorset village.

A key feature of Warmwell Rise is the generous green infrastructure created as part of the development, which has been designed to benefit both future residents and the wider community and includes accessible natural open space for walking, recreation and wildlife, alongside a dedicated outdoor play space for children.

Green Spaces Designed for Everyday Life

The design of the green open space encourages everyday outdoor activity close to home, with walking routes and landscaped areas that are freely accessible and intended to be enjoyed by the wider Crossways community, not just those living at the development.

Investment That Supports the Wider Area

Alongside the on-site green spaces, Warmwell Rise will bring £1,379,178 to local improvements through the Community Infrastructure Levy, which Dorset Council will receive to support wider infrastructure such as transport, education, open spaces and community facilities across the area.

Homes Designed for Modern Living

Warmwell Rise will deliver a mixture of two, three and four-bedroom homes, including 49 affordable homes, which feature practical layouts, spacious interiors and energy-efficient design and sit comfortably within their surroundings through careful landscaping and pedestrian-friendly routes that connect the development to the wider area.
